Commit Graph

2806 Commits

Author SHA1 Message Date
Max
2983aa5737 htpasswd only on given paths
Only apply htpasswd rules to (sub)domains if the rule's path begins with the domain's document root.
2019-01-14 00:18:26 +01:00
Michael Kaufmann
9a906427e7 ensure the replacing of the stdsubdomain url on update is encoded correctly
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2019-01-11 08:55:55 +01:00
Michael Kaufmann
7841eebf08 correct handling of storeSettingHostname when system.stdsubdomain is changed; refs #633
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2019-01-11 00:06:44 +01:00
Michael Kaufmann
b4597d54af create full dns zone if main-but-subdomain has dns enabled but maindomain to that domain does not, fixes #632
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2019-01-08 12:52:10 +01:00
Michael Kaufmann
19ffc9587a issubof Parameter in Domains.add and Domains.update is not boolean
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2019-01-08 11:18:53 +01:00
Michael Kaufmann
0cc5693180 damn typo
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2019-01-06 08:54:49 +01:00
Michael Kaufmann
045a62a9db remove duplcate visible-field in admin-edit formfield; fixes #625
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2019-01-06 08:48:24 +01:00
Michael Kaufmann
725372b6ae add 4th parameter $step to Admins::increaseUsage(); fixes #628
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2019-01-06 08:45:24 +01:00
Michael Kaufmann
9e77fecc29 removed deprectated create_function statement; fixes #623
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2019-01-06 08:39:56 +01:00
Michael Kaufmann
f3859052e5 fix getParamListFromDoc() for api doc
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2019-01-05 07:56:55 +01:00
Michael Kaufmann
2b4199e558 drop ADSP support, fixes #622
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2019-01-04 20:58:20 +01:00
Michael Kaufmann
92b133b11d fix Froxlor::listFunction() api-call after namespacing
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2019-01-02 18:36:01 +01:00
Michael Kaufmann
5dda57458a fix incorrect variable
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-28 15:18:56 +01:00
Michael Kaufmann
16efd1191a forgot to remove require of formfield-constants
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-26 21:12:58 +01:00
Michael Kaufmann
1c9d76725c get rid of last function file
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-26 20:54:00 +01:00
Michael Kaufmann
e64e8cafa6 define logger constants in logger class
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-26 15:51:26 +01:00
Michael Kaufmann
3949a6858b fixed to Cron
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-26 12:00:32 +01:00
Michael Kaufmann
792d25fdd8 add MysqlHandler for Monolog-Logger
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-25 08:48:28 +01:00
Michael Kaufmann
684130871b forgot one function in Froxlor\PhpHelper
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-24 14:04:52 +01:00
Michael Kaufmann
7416a41a42 get rid of most of the checkstyle warnings
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-24 13:50:45 +01:00
Michael Kaufmann
30f5902b88 fix some more checkstyle issues
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-24 13:21:35 +01:00
Michael Kaufmann
35c631946d more and more checkstyle fixes
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-24 12:59:40 +01:00
Michael Kaufmann
585d42f1b8 more checkstyle fixes
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-24 12:02:26 +01:00
Michael Kaufmann
c3d44b4558 Minor enhancements and starting to comply with checkstyle
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-24 09:35:05 +01:00
Michael Kaufmann
04e87cce98 forgot to add a few statics... :p
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-23 19:49:10 +01:00
Michael Kaufmann
4cd005051b fixed last remaining function calls which are class-methods now
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-23 19:34:32 +01:00
Michael Kaufmann
7f82038255 fix up some cron related things
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-22 20:01:10 +01:00
Michael Kaufmann
c1cd0004bf fix saving of settings
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-22 15:52:20 +01:00
Michael Kaufmann
3794003e63 minor fixes here and there
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-22 13:42:10 +01:00
Michael Kaufmann
13aa19e5f4 got rid of all global functions, I guess
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-22 13:28:51 +01:00
Michael Kaufmann
28bb614489 begin refactoring of form-stuff
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-22 11:57:54 +01:00
Michael Kaufmann
085d25346d remove unneeded include of functions.php
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-22 10:37:33 +01:00
Michael Kaufmann
685267d6fc fix CLI scripts
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-22 10:36:01 +01:00
Michael Kaufmann
0401e6971a Revert "refactor global array"
This reverts commit c5a58e3f36.
2018-12-22 08:15:31 +01:00
Michael Kaufmann
7e39a7bc60 Revert "refactor global array"
This reverts commit 370ccbdb74.
2018-12-22 08:15:31 +01:00
Michael Kaufmann
c800e89414 Revert "fix wrong usage of \Froxlor\User::getAll()"
This reverts commit 48ff2e6b6d.
2018-12-22 08:15:31 +01:00
Michael Kaufmann
e719731de0 Revert "argh..."
This reverts commit fed9efff41.
2018-12-22 08:15:30 +01:00
Michael Kaufmann
fed9efff41 argh...
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-21 21:00:35 +01:00
Michael Kaufmann
48ff2e6b6d fix wrong usage of \Froxlor\User::getAll()
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-21 20:56:47 +01:00
Michael Kaufmann
370ccbdb74 refactor global array
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-21 20:51:44 +01:00
Michael Kaufmann
c5a58e3f36 refactor global array
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-21 20:31:17 +01:00
Michael Kaufmann
7c68fa7bd0 fixed a few functions I've missed
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-21 19:16:49 +01:00
Michael Kaufmann
7563907df5 convert html-related functions
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-21 18:31:06 +01:00
Michael Kaufmann
def3d6d19e forgot generateDkimEntries()
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-21 17:56:23 +01:00
Michael Kaufmann
59453a47fa fix dns-related function calls
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-21 17:51:29 +01:00
Michael Kaufmann
1b090377ee even more function to class conversion
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-21 17:41:22 +01:00
Michael Kaufmann
b0e11f5708 and more and more and more
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-21 17:00:54 +01:00
Michael Kaufmann
a819d81ef2 more function reducing and fixing
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-21 16:53:04 +01:00
Michael Kaufmann
0a28ef2af6 minor changes for unit-tests
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-21 16:32:44 +01:00
Michael Kaufmann
1ba4164028 add new PHPMail Wrapper to avoid multiple setting of properties
Signed-off-by: Michael Kaufmann <d00p@froxlor.org>
2018-12-21 14:49:55 +01:00